    Delhi's air quality index (AQI) stood at 365 at 8 am on Tuesday, improving from 395 at 4 pm on Monday. Th ...More

    Delhi's air quality index (AQI) stood at 365 at 8 am on Tuesday, improving from 395 at 4 pm on Monday. The AQI at any given time is the average of readings taken in the last 24 hours. An AQI between zero and 50 is considered 'good', 51 and 100 'satisfactory', 101 and 200 'moderate', 201 and 300 'poor', 301 and 400 'very poor', 401 and 450 'severe' and above 450 'severe-plus'. ...Less

  • As Delhi chokes, power plants are set to miss emissions deadline

    Eight of the plants, whose operators include Vedanta, L&T and Uttar Pradesh Power Corp., have yet to orde ...More

    Eight of the plants, whose operators include Vedanta, L&T and Uttar Pradesh Power Corp., have yet to order the required flue-gas desulfurization units, as per the Central Electricity Authority. The units can take as long as three years to secure and install, and it’s unclear if the operators will be penalized by authorities if they miss the deadline. ...Less

  • India takes new steps to kick old habits of stubble burning

    Farmers are often blamed for northern India’s terrible air quality. Every winter, smoke from stubble burn ...More

    Farmers are often blamed for northern India’s terrible air quality. Every winter, smoke from stubble burning mixes with construction dust and industrial emissions to produce a toxic cocktail that blots out the sun, grounds flights and overwhelms hospitals. The haze lingers in the region’s trough-like topography for weeks. ...Less
